Mr. Speaker, I include in the Record a Military.com article entitled ``Defense Bills Would Provide New Food Allowance for Low- Income Military Families.'' [From Military.com, July 27, 2021] Defense Bills Would Provide New Food Allowance for Low-Income Military Families (By Patricia Kime) A House panel is weighing a $770 billion defense policy bill that includes a provision to give lower-income military families a basic needs allowance--a stipend that advocacy groups say would relieve stress and ``food insecurity'' among U.S. troops. The draft of the House's 2022 National Defense Authorization Act released Tuesday contains a provision similar to the Senate's proposal that would provide service members additional money for food and other basics if their household incomes do not exceed 130% of the federal poverty level--which in 2021 meant $21,960 for a family of three, $26,500 for a family of four, and slightly higher for even larger families. This is the third time the proposal has been incorporated into the House defense policy bill; unlike previous years, it also has been included in the 2022 Senate defense bill, increasing the likelihood that it will pass later this year. For an E-4 with several years in the military, a spouse and two children, the stipend could equate to roughly $250 extra a month.…
